Understanding the Technology Behind 5G

5G works across various frequencies, including new, high millimeter-wave bands between 28 GHz and 39 GHz. These high frequencies make 5G faster and more efficient. Older frequency bands are still important in 5G, ensuring a smooth change from 4G.

Key Components of a 5G Network

The heart of a 5G network is its Radio Access Network (RAN) and the powerful 5G Core. This setup is crucial for fast data handling and minimal delay. It’s a step up from 4G, allowing more devices to connect at once and enabling new tech breakthroughs in various fields.

Differences Between 4G and 5G

5G beats 4G by a landslide when it comes to speed and performance. Download speeds can hit up to 20 Gbps under perfect conditions. Latency, or delay time, is super low, making things like online gaming or remote surgery work smoothly. Plus, 5G can handle more data at once, improving how we connect and use technology.

Enhanced Speeds and Reduced Latency

5G lets users enjoy faster data transmission, with speeds up to 10 Gbps. This boost makes streaming smoother, downloads quicker, and gaming better. It also brings low latency communication, down to 1 ms. This means online games and video calls are much more seamless and quick.

5G Infrastructure Development Challenges

The rollout of 5G infrastructure faces many hurdles. These challenges include high costs and complex rules about spectrum use. They affect how and where we can get 5G services.

High Costs of Implementation

Setting up 5G requires a lot of money. Companies need to spend a lot on the right equipment and technology. This makes it hard for smaller companies to join the market. These costs slow down how quickly 5G can be set up as companies watch their budgets.

Spectrum Availability and Regulation

Getting access to the right frequencies is another big challenge. There’s limited access to the frequencies we want for 5G. Rules and auctions for these frequencies make it even harder. This makes it tough for companies to get what they need for the best 5G service. It slows down building the infrastructure.

Case Studies of Successful Implementation

5G has really made things better for cities that have it. For example, San Francisco has put 5G to work in its buses and trains. This gives commuters updates as they happen. Dallas has used 5G for smarter ways to use energy and better public services. These successes show how 5G can truly change things.
